Abstract
A digitally controlled, presettable, ramp signal generating arrangement comprising digital to analogue converter means (DA) and integrator means (A1, A2) having a first mode in which its output (0) assumes a value representative of the output of the converter means, and a second mode in which its output changes at a rate dependent on the output of the converter means. The arrangement finds especial application in symbol display arrangements.
